PLANNING COMMISSION MEETING HELD MARCH 18, 1991 <br />(#1)ZONING FILE 11457-ALAN CARLSON CONTINUED <br />opportunities to Oi.tlot C. There are six properties that could <br />be used to gain access to Outlet C. 3y providing a future <br />east/west road, as requested by the City, I have added another <br />means of access. I understand that the resolution would state <br />that I could not develop Outlot C until I can provide access." <br />Mabusth asked Carlson to indicate where, in Outlot B, the <br />970 foot elevation is located in relation to the proposed tennis <br />court. <br />Carlson indicated the location of the 970 foot elevation <br />Mabusth said, "If it is where Mr. Carlson has indicated, the <br />tennis court would encroach into the wetland area." <br />Kelley asked Carlson if he intends to install monuments at <br />the entrance to the development. <br />Carlson stated that he so intended and referred the Planning <br />Commission to the plan showing the monuments. <br />Kelley asked Carlson if ha intends to place lights on the <br />monuments. <br />Carlson indicated that he had not given any thought to <br />lighting. <br />Kelley asked Staff if Carlson will obtain private easements <br />for the maintenance of the monuments. <br />Mabusth replied, "That the resolution approving the original <br />plan had included language regarding the monuments. If the <br />monuments are placed not within the road outlot, but on the <br />adjacent residential lots, it will be necessary for Mr. Carlson <br />to obtain easements from the future land owners." <br />Bellows observed that the change in elevation may pose a <br />problem if the monuments are placed too far out of the road <br />outlot. She stated that the elevation on one side of the road <br />differs from the other, and was concerned about the need to raise <br />one monument higher to equal the height of the other. <br />Carlson stated that he would cut into the ground on the west <br />side to reduce the height to be the same as the monument on the <br />east side. <br />Kelley suggested including language in the resolution that <br />would allow the monuments to be no more than six feet from the <br />grade level of Outlot A.
